| Product Name | Thermus thermophilus Single-Stranded DNA-Binding Protein (TthSSB) |
| Overview | The single-stranded DNA-binding protein from Thermus thermophilus (TthSSB) is a thermostable protein that binds single-stranded DNA (ssDNA) with high affinity and specificity. TthSSB plays a critical role in DNA replication, recombination, and repair in this thermophilic bacterium. Its remarkable stability and activity at elevated temperatures make it particularly valuable for molecular biology applications that require robust ssDNA stabilization under thermal cycling or high-temperature conditions. TthSSB is structurally similar to other bacterial SSBs, functioning as a homotetramer, and is widely used to enhance the efficiency and fidelity of PCR and other DNA amplification techniques. |
